How to fill out material damage

How to fill out material damage
01
To fill out material damage, follow these steps:
02
Gather all necessary information: This includes details about the damaged property, such as its location, type, condition, and extent of damage.
03
Take photographs: Document the damage by taking clear and detailed photographs from different angles. These visual records will be helpful during the claim process.
04
Provide a description: Write a thorough description of the material damage, including the cause of the damage and any relevant circumstances.
05
Assess the value: Determine the value of the damaged material by considering its original cost, age, depreciation, and any applicable market value.
06
Submit the claim: Forward all the gathered information, photographs, and description to the appropriate authorities or insurance company for further processing.
07
Cooperate with the investigation: If required, cooperate with any investigation process related to the material damage claim by providing additional details or supporting documents.
08
Await the claim settlement: Once the claim is submitted, wait for the authorities or insurance company to review the case and provide a settlement amount or coverage for the material damage.
09
Follow up if necessary: If there are any delays or issues with the claim processing, follow up with the authorities or insurance company for clarification and resolution.
Who needs material damage?
01
Material damage insurance is beneficial for:
02
- Homeowners: It helps protect their property against unexpected events such as fire, vandalism, or natural disasters.
03
- Business owners: It safeguards their physical assets, including buildings, equipment, and inventory from various risks.
04
- Tenants: It covers their personal belongings and any damages that they may cause to the rented property.
05
- Vehicle owners: It provides coverage against damages or losses to their vehicle due to accidents, theft, or other incidents.
06
- Individuals with valuable possessions: It offers protection for valuable items like jewelry, art, or collectibles against theft, damage, or loss.
07
- Construction companies: It assists in covering the cost of repairing or replacing materials, tools, or equipment used in construction projects in case of damage or theft.
08
- Manufacturers: It helps in reducing financial losses caused by damage or loss of raw materials, finished goods, machinery, or equipment.
09
- Renters: It offers coverage for their personal belongings in case of theft, fire, or other covered events.
10
- Anyone who wants to protect their assets and minimize financial risks associated with material damage.

What is material damage?
Material damage refers to physical harm or destruction to property or belongings.
Who is required to file material damage?
The individual or organization that has experienced the material damage is required to file a report.
How to fill out material damage?
Material damage can be filled out by providing details of the incident, including date, location, extent of damage, and any other relevant information.
What is the purpose of material damage?
The purpose of filing material damage is to document and report the harm or destruction caused to property or belongings.
What information must be reported on material damage?
Information such as date of incident, location, extent of damage, value of property, and any other relevant details must be reported on material damage.
